Busan Transportation Corporation Conducts Response Drill for Personal Mobility Device Fires

Joint Disaster Preparedness Training by Fire Department, Police, and Subsidiaries

Response Check for Personal Mobility Device Fire and Derailment Scenarios

Busan Transportation Corporation (President Lee Byungjin) conducted a comprehensive disaster response drill on the 20th at the Daejeo Train Depot, simulating a fire involving a personal mobility device.


This drill was part of the corporation's "2024 Year-Round Disaster Preparedness Training" and was attended by more than 80 officials from related organizations such as Gangseo Fire Station, Gangseo Police Station, and Busan Urban Railway Operation Service. The focus was on checking the cooperation system in complex disaster situations such as fires and derailments, and enhancing practical response capabilities.


The scenario assumed a fire involving a personal mobility device carried by a passenger on Line 3. After the train stopped at the adjacent Daejeo Station, the scenario included passenger evacuation, initial fire suppression, and notification to relevant agencies, followed by emergency dispatches from fire and police departments to extinguish the fire, rescue passengers, and restore facilities.

Subsequently, the drill also simulated a derailment caused by a signal error resulting from the fire, with recovery operations conducted for each sector, including vehicles, electricity, signals, communications, and facilities. By planning for complex disaster situations that could actually occur, the corporation checked its disaster response capabilities to prepare for unexpected accidents.


The year-round disaster preparedness training is designed so that each institution can independently plan based on its specific disaster environment, identify areas for improvement, and make practical enhancements to the disaster response system. In 2023, the corporation identified the need for cooperation between police and staff to control accident sites and incorporated this into the current drill.


Lee Byungjin, President of Busan Transportation Corporation, stated, "Through drills that closely resemble real-life situations, we were able to review inter-agency cooperation systems and improve our staff's disaster response proficiency. We will do our utmost to respond swiftly and prioritize the safety and lives of passengers in all unforeseen railway disaster situations."
